Job description

We are looking for a dynamic and proactive Learning and Development Manager to join our Human Resources Department. In this role, you will be responsible for driving the Bank’s training strategy, enhancing employee skills, and fostering a positive organisational culture through learning, development, and engagement initiatives. This is an excellent opportunity to contribute to the growth and development of our workforce within a leading international bank.

Responsibilities
  • Assist in formulating and implementing the Bank’s learning and development strategy to meet organisational and employee development needs.
  • Plan, coordinate and administer local and Head Office training programmes in collaboration with internal and external trainers.
  • Manage the annual training budget to ensure effective utilisation of resources and compliance with budgetary limits.
  • Conduct post-training evaluations and prepare analysis and reports on training effectiveness.
  • Generate and maintain regular training statistics and management reports.
  • Plan and organise employee engagement and cultural development activities to promote a positive work culture and strengthen staff cohesion.
  • Provide administrative and logistical support for all learning development and engagement initiatives.
Requirements
  • Bachelor’s degree from a recognised university or relevant professional qualification.
  • Minimum 3 to 5 years of experience in learning and development preferably within the banking or financial services industry.
  • Independent, resourceful and able to work effectively in a fast-paced, multi-tasking environment.
  • Proficient in both English and Chinese so as to liaise with Chinese-speaking counterparts.
  • Strong interpersonal, communication and presentation skills.
